Legal Notice

Business Name
Fig Tree Media
Address
Flat 10 21 Reminder Lane, London, SE10 0UH, United Kingdom
Registered Company Name
Fig Tree Media
Registered Office Address
Flat 10 21 Reminder Lane London SE10 0UH